Choose the odd one out from the group of terms given below and write the category for the remaining terms:
विकल्प
Uterus
Ureter
Oviduct
Ovaries
Advertisements
उत्तर
Ureter
Explanation:
The uterus, Oviduct, and Ovaries are female reproductive organs.

Read the following and answer from given below:
During copulation, semen is released by the penis into the vegina. The motile sperms swim rapidly, fuse with the ovum in the ampullary region, resulting in fertilization. The haploid nucleus of sperm fuses with that of the ovum to form a diploid zygote.
Site of fertilization in human is ______
Read the following and answer from given below:
Oogenesis is the process of the formation of an ovum in the ovaries. It consists of three phases: multiplication, growth, and maturation. Oogenesis is controlled by hormones GnRH, LH, FSH. GnRH secreted by the hypothalamus stimulates the anterior lobe of the pituitary gland to secrete LH and FSH.
Identify the functions of LH.
- Release of a secondary oocyte from Graafian follicle.
- Stimulates corpus luteum to secrete progesterone.
- Stimulates estrogen formation.
- Promotes development of egg to form secondary oocyte.
